1
0
mirror of https://github.com/django/django.git synced 2025-10-24 06:06:09 +00:00

Made Model.__eq__ consider proxy models equivalent

Fixed #11892, fixed #16458, fixed #14492.
This commit is contained in:
Anssi Kääriäinen
2013-08-07 09:51:32 +03:00
parent 4090982617
commit 4668c142dc
7 changed files with 60 additions and 1 deletions

View File

@@ -707,6 +707,10 @@ class ModelTest(TestCase):
with self.assertRaises(ObjectDoesNotExist):
SelfRef.objects.get(selfref=sr)
def test_eq(self):
self.assertNotEqual(Article(id=1), object())
self.assertNotEqual(object(), Article(id=1))
class ConcurrentSaveTests(TransactionTestCase):